PERSONAL

The many friends of Air J. H. Perrett, of Sanson, will regret to learn that lie is •confined to his bed with a serious illness.

Air E. R. Short.!, now of More re, H. 8., was in Eeilding yesterday -e. nowing acquaintances. He returned this afternoon.

Air 11. E. Tripe, who has been appointed associate u> Air Justice Blair, will take up the position .t Auckland this week. He will be missed in cricketing circles in Wellington, as ho was a popular member of the University senior eleven.

Ur. Raymond Fair, a young Auckland anthropologist, is visiting his parents at Otahuhu prior to taking up liis residence for two years on a lonel.v island of the Solomon Group, under appointment by the Australian Research Council, to study its anthropology. Ho will )>e the* sole white man. among some 500 Polynesians.
